H-infinity Control and Estimation of State-multiplicative Linear Systems
Autor Eli Gershon, Uri Shaked, Isaac Yaeshen Limba Engleză Paperback – 24 iun 2005
This monograph embodies a comprehensive survey of the relevant literature with basic problems being formulated and solved by applying various techniques including game theory, linear matrix inequalities and Lyapunov parameter-dependent functions.
Topics covered include: convex H2 and H-infinity norms analysis of systems with multiplicative noise; state feedback control and state estimation of systems with multiplicative noise; dynamic and static output feedback of stochastic bilinear systems; tracking controllers for stochastic bilinear systems utilizing preview information.
Various examples which demonstrate the applicability of the theory to practical control engineering problems are considered; two such examples are taken from the aerospace and guidance control areas.

Part I: Introduction and Literature Survey: Introduction.- Part II: Continuous-time Systems: Control and Luenberger-type Filtering; General Filtering; Tracking Control; Static Output-feedback; Stochastic Passivity.- Part III: Discrete-time Systems: Control and Luenberger-type Filtering; General Filtering; Tracking Control; Static Output-feedback.- Part IV: Applications: Systems with State-multiplicative Noise: Applications.- Appendix A Introduction to Stochastic Differential Equations.- Appendix B The Continuous DLMI Method.- Appendix C The Discrete DLMI Method.
